## Closure: Aldervane Office (Managers Only)

The Aldervane satellite office closes end of Q3. Leases terminate; staff transfer to the Corrick Hub or remote roles. Department heads confirm reassignments by Friday. Equipment returns go through Facilities; no local disposal. Do not discuss outside this group until HR finishes notifications. The rationale ties directly to next year's consolidation strategy, summarized below.

board note of tadup-tajog: Headcount on the Oliiel team goes from 31 to 88 by the end of February. Gross margin on Oliiel came in at 62 percent against a plan of 29 percent.

When the Larkspur catalog service invalidates a cache entry, every storefront node re-fetches independently, which is why we saw the thundering-herd spike during the spring promo. We've since added jittered TTLs and a stale-while-revalidate window, so support should expect brief periods where shoppers see prices up to a few minutes old — this is intentional, not a bug. If a merchant reports stale data beyond that window, escalate to the catalog team rather than flushing caches manually. The current invalidation parameters are listed below.

tuning table, fawip-fahag:
WEIGHTS = {
    "novwyn": 452,
    "casdor": 675,
}

The Penwhistle calendar connector reconciles events between the local store and remote providers. When both sides edit the same event inside one sync window, the conflict resolver queues both versions and applies last-writer-wins with a tombstone grace period. To keep reconciliation bounded, we enforce per-account quotas on queued conflicts, sync window length, and resolver retries. Exceeding a quota pauses the account rather than dropping events; maintainers should resume manually after inspection. Enforcement uses the constants below.

tuning constants:
QUOTAS = {
    "druwyn": 5,
    "holix": 5,
    "zorath": 5,
    "holwyn": 10,
}

## 3.2.0 — Setting renamed

Context for new folks: version 3.1 shipped a fix for the image-cache memory leak in Pictogrammet (evicted thumbnails weren't being released, heap grew unbounded). That fix introduced `CACHE_EVICT_TOKEN`, which was a bad name — it's actually the auth secret for the eviction sidecar, not a tuning knob. As of 3.2.0 it's renamed and the old name is ignored. Update every environment file before deploying; the sidecar hard-fails on the legacy key. Your env file should now contain this line:

sealed setting: COURIER_KEY8=0dbae41b